STILLWATER, MN — Blue Sun Soda Shop, a company known for its crazy flavors, is set to open a new location this weekend in downtown Stillwater. Blue Sun Soda Shop is planning to host a grand opening at 11 a.m. Saturday to throw open the doors to its new space at 126 Main St. South, the former site of Uncommon Cents. The grand-opening event is scheduled to run until 7 p.m. Saturday and will feature Twin Cities favorite Billy the Soda Jerk from 11 a.m. to 1 p.m., according to the event posting on Facebook. Blue Sun Soda Shop calls itself the "world's largest soda shop" and "Minnesota's original craft soda shop and candy store."
